2010-06-02 10 views
10

J'ai certaines anciennes sources écrites en Visual Basic. Il y a les fichiers *.bas, *.cls, *.frm et *.vbp. Si je comprends bien, vbp est un fichier de projet. Mais je ne peux pas l'ouvrir avec mon Visual Studio 2008.Ouverture vbp Visual Basic Project

Quelle version de VS devrais-je installer pour ouvrir le fichier *.vbp? Google dit que c'est Visual Studio 6, mais je ne suis pas sûr et je ne peut pas trouver Visual Studio 6 pour le téléchargement. Existe-t-il une édition gratuite de Visual Studio 6 avec Visual Basic?

Merci. Vbp est en effet un fichier de projet VB 5/6

Répondre

9

VS6/VB5/VB6 ne sont pas gratuits, donc si vous voulez construire le projet, vous devrez dépenser 5 $ sur ebay.

Le VB5 Control Creation Edition (composants COM de construction seulement) était la seule version libre MS publiée. Les anciennes versions de VS.net comprenaient un moyen d'importer un VBP et de le mettre à niveau vers VB.NET, mais YMMV (de façon significative).

Modifier; Si vous voulez juste regarder la structure source/projet tous les fichiers sauf .frx sont des ascii simples.

5

Si vous avez un abonnement MSDN, alors VB6 est available en téléchargement gratuit. Sinon, comme Alex suggère, mais il en coûte généralement beaucoup plus que 5 $.

1

Lors de l'ouverture du fichier vbp qui est le fichier de projet, vous aurez très probablement un assistant d'importation, qui après avoir essayé d'importer le projet, vous dira probablement qu'il y a un tas de dépendances que vb6 utilise. net ne fait pas et va erreur. Vous devez avoir vb5/6 installé ou au moins les fichiers de dépendance installés afin de procéder à l'importation. Vous pouvez afficher le code source à partir des fichiers texte ascii simples des fichiers .frM.

+0

+1 Il faut aussi savoir que l'importation (ou migration) code VB6 à VB2008 peut exiger beaucoup d'efforts. http://stackoverflow.com/questions/tagged?tagnames=vb6-migration&sort=votes&pagesize=15 – MarkJ